Hilary Putnam had many achievements in the field of philosophy. Here's some context about his concept of "brain in a vat"[1], in his 1981 book, "Reason, Truth and History".
The brain-in-a-vat concept was famously used in the The Matrix films.[2]
A summary from Philosophy Index: "The example supposes that a mad scientist has removed your brain, and placed it into a vat of liquid to keep it alive and active. The scientist has also connected your brain to a powerful computer, which sends neurological signals to the brain in the way the brain normally receives them. Thus, the computer is able to send your brain data to fool you into believing that you are still walking around in your body."
"The brain-in-a-vat thought experiment is generally used to ask the question: how do you know that you are not a brain in a vat? The question mirrors an early one from Descartes, which asks how you are to know that there is not an evil demon feeding false information to your senses. The essential conclusion is that, from the perspective of the brain itself, it is impossible to tell whether it is a brain in a vat or a brain in a skull." [1][3]

> Below the world of worms and burrowing snails we may consider microscopic creatures like the ameba, who oozes along by pushing out lobes or ruffles of his single cell protoplasm and just flowing into them. His locomotion system (often called "ruffling") was only recently elucidated. It works in each lobe something like an advancing jet of jelly that spreads like the crown of a fountain at its forward end, turning outward in all directions, then back in the form of a surrounding cuff that condenses into a sleeve stiff enough to grip the ground until, turning once more in the rear, it liquefies and pours inward through the center. Biologists used to think that a muscle-like squeezing of the sleeve's protoplasm at the hind end pushed the jelly forward like toothpaste out of its tube, but newer evidence strongly indicates that it is the continuous contraction of the jelly at the forward "fountain zone" (where it turns and stiffens) that literally pulls the central stream steadily ahead. So the consensus of opinion now is that the ameba advances somewhat as does an oriental king, by having his carpet swiftly unrolled before him as he walks, then as nimbly rerolled behind for further unrolling ahead.
> Another method of microbe locomotion, up to several hundred times faster but still slow in human terms, is that of flagella or bacilli with tails. Some of them propel themselves by a recently discovered swivel motion, each flagellum lash rotating freely about its axis like the rigid propeller of a small airplane, generally pulling from the front end and changing course by reversing the direction of rotation. So far as I know, this is the only true wheel motion produced by nature before man invented the wheel about 3500 B.C. and it is powered by the equivalent of a reversible microscopic engine, something technological man has not learned how to make even today.
> A different system again is that adopted by ciliates, common in mud and ponds, whose bodies are covered with thousands of rapidly waving hairs called cilia. Up to 20 times a second each cilium (one thousandth of an inch long) makes its stroke, much like a human swimmer's arm action, first reaching gently forward edgewise for minimum resistance, then sweeping rigidly backward broadside for maximum resistance, the beats coordinated in beautiful rhythmic waves of succession, like pistons in an engine or stalks of wheat blowing in the wind. Even some visible animals use ciliated drive, notably two kinds of comb jellyfish the sizes of a gooseberry and a walnut, and often called respectively the "sea gooseberry" and "sea walnut," each of which has eight longitudinal belts of cilia (coordinated by a special balance organ) that steer and propel it like a spherical Caterpillar tractor.
Good question. As far as the thought experiment itself, it's really just a modern phrasing of Descartes' thought experiment. I have no idea if Putnam was even the first to mention a BIV.[0]
The real novelty is Putnam's response, based on the causal theory of reference or content externalism or something like it (I'm fuzzy on this point). I hope I can do it justice from memory.
He argues that because the brain in a vat has never had the appropriate sort of causal contact with external objects, its thoughts don't refer to them. So the brain has whatever brain states go on in me when I think "the sky is blue", but it has never seen the sky, and so its mental states don't refer to the sky. They refer to something else. Probably some disjunctive property of however the apparatus stimulates the brain's nerves (it's really hard to say what this is). It turns out then, that the brain is not falsely believing/failing to know the facts that we might think about by thinking "the sky is blue", it's accurately representing some other kinds of facts. So that type of scepticism is self-undermining, because it attributes thoughts to the BIV that it couldn't possibly have.
